jQuery 上传插件 jquery-upload
- 授权协议: 未知
- 开发语言: JavaScript
- 操作系统: 跨平台
- 软件首页: http://festatic.aliapp.com/#jquery-upload
- 软件文档: http://festatic.aliapp.com/js/jquery-upload/
- 官方下载: http://festatic.aliapp.com/js/jquery-upload/
软件介绍
1、插件说明
在支持FormData的浏览器完全使用AJAX(即XMLHttpRequest)和input的files属性共同完成上传文件,否则就模拟表单提交来上传文件。支持写的文章和脚本现在看起来都比较稚嫩,现在重新整理、约束,更好的API和便捷使用方法。
插件名称:jquery-upload。
2、插件使用
// 1、判断浏览器支持特征
// 是否支持HTML5的input的files对象,用于同时选择上传多张图片 $.support.inputFiles;
// 是否支持HTML5的FormData,用于AJAX提交 $.support.formData;
// 2、默认参数 $.fn.upload.defaults = {
// 提交地址 action: "",
// 传递额外数据(键值对字符串) data: null,
// 表单文件的name值 inputName: "file",
// 文件最小容量(单位B,默认0) minSize: 0,
// 文件最大容量(单位B,默认1M=1024KB=1024*1024B) maxSize: 1048576,
// 文件类型(文件后缀) fileType: ["png", "jpg", "jpeg", "gif"],
// 错误消息提示 errorMsg: {
// 单文件上传错误或失败 singleError: "第{n}个文件上传错误或失败",
// 多文件上传错误或失败 multiError: "上传错误或失败",
// 单文件未选择 singleNone: "尚未选择第{n}个上传文件",
// 多文件未选择 multiNone: "尚未选择任何上传文件",
// 多文件列表为空 empty: "待上传文件为空",
// 单、多文件错误,{n}表示该文件的序号,开始序号为1 type: "第{n}个文件类型不符合要求", size: "第{n}个文件容量不符合要求" },
// 完成回调,无论成功还是失败 oncomplete: emptyFn, // 成功回调 onsuccess: emptyFn,
// 失败回调 onerror: emptyFn,
// 进度回调 onprogress: emptyFn };
// 3、上传文件 $("#file").upload({ action: "upload.php" });
// 4、增加文件MIME配对关系
// 添加单个 $.fn.upload.addTypeRelationship("text/html", "html");
// 添加多个 $.fn.upload.addTypeRelationship({ "text/html": "html", "text/xhtml": "xhtml" });3、插件演示及下载
写给Web开发人员看的HTML5教程
2012-3 / 45.00元
《写给Web开发人员看的HTML5教程》通过结合大量实际案例和源代码对HTML5的重要特性进行了详细讲解,内容全面丰富,易于理解。全书共分为12章,从HTML5的历史故事讲起,涉及了文档结构和语义、智能表单、视频与音频、画布、SVG与MathML、地理定位、Web存储与离线Web应用程序、WebSockets套接字、WebWorker多线程、微数据以及以拖曳为代表的一些全局属性,涵盖了HTML5所......一起来看看 《写给Web开发人员看的HTML5教程》 这本书的介绍吧!
